Jobcon Logo Job Description :

Registered Nurse 1 - Specialty - Per DiemThe Registered Nurse 1 - Specialty - Per Diem delivers patient-family centered care in a culturally competent manner utilizing evidence-based standards of quality, safety, and service while ensuring population-specific patient care.Core Job Functions:Assesses assigned patients and evaluates plans to include documentation of nursing care.Reports symptoms and changes in patients' condition and vital signs.Modifies patient treatment plans as indicated by patients' responses and conditions, and physician orders.Reviews, evaluates, and reports diagnostic tests to assess patient's condition.Consults with physicians and other healthcare professionals related to assigned patients to assess, plan, implement and evaluate patient care plans.Prepares patients for, and assists with examinations, procedures, and treatments. Considers patient age and culture during patient treatments and provides any needed information regarding treatment plan. Nurtures a compassionate environment by providing psychological support.Performs appropriate patient tests and safely administers medications within the scope of practice. Administers and maintains accurate records related to medications and treatments as per regulatory bodies, policies, procedures, and physician orders.Communicates plan of care in a timely manner to patient and family, as well as the appropriate team members, ensuring compliance with all regulatory guidelines (i.e., HIPAA). Uses best practices for transition of patient care.Utilizes available resources to assist in discharge planning.Plans, prioritizes, and adjusts assignments to accomplish goals and render superior patient care; seeks assistance when needed.Adapts to changing work demands and environment.Operates the appropriate medical equipment.Adheres to University and unit-level policies and procedures and safeguards University assets.Core Qualifications:Education: Bachelor's degree in relevant field requiredExperience: No previous experience requiredCertification and Licensing: Valid State of Florida RN license requiredKnowledge, Skills and Abilities:Learning Agility: Ability to learn new procedures, technologies, and protocols, and adapt to changing priorities and work demands.Teamwork: Ability to work collaboratively with others and contribute to a team environment.Technical Proficiency: Skilled in using office software, technology, and relevant computer applications.Communication: Strong and clear written and verbal communication skills for interacting with colleagues and stakeholders.The University of Miami offers competitive salaries and a comprehensive benefits package including medical, dental, tuition remission and more.
